      • Generic Image womnsheart says

        I found Me Again Vaginal Moisturizer at CVS Online.  I checked and they still carry it — search under vaginal moisturizer. I had my ovaries removed last year so I use the Vagifem which has estrogen in it twice per week because I don’t have any and I noticed shrinkage.  The Me Again Vaginal Moisturizer doesn’t have estrogen, but lubricates like I used to :) .  If you don’t need estrogen or can’t use estrogen for some reason, but have occasional dryness, the Me Again is fabulous.  It is a little tube that you insert before sex or whenever you feel uncomfortably dry.  Hope that helps.
